Doctor, Non Locals Among 7 Killed, 5 Others Injured In Militant Attack In Ganderbal

Srinagar: At least seven people including a doctor from Budgam and five non locals were killed while several other people were injured in a major militant attack in Ganderbal district on Sunday evening. No consensus on long-range weapons for Ukraine: Biden

No consensus on long-range weapons for Ukraine: Biden

BERLIN: US President Joe Biden said on Friday that there was no consensus for giving Ukraine long-range weapons that President Volodymyr Zel­ensky has been requesting Western nations for months to conduct deeper strikes into Russia. “Right now, there’s no consensus for long-range weapons,” Biden told reporters in Berlin .
